McKinney Boyd Track Meet: Rangers find a way to make the Podium!

-

McKinney Boyd from February 17-18 hosted the Jesuit Ranger’s track team at Ron Poe Stadium in their first local meet.

“We had a lot of success but a lot of struggling, It was a learning experience that will motivate us for the rest of the season. – Logan Thompson ’24 EIC

The most notable of finishes was the Ranger relay team, composed of Caden Cutchall ’24, Ben McKinney ’23, Henry Beckman ’24, and Charlie Thornton ’24 who broke the previous record of 8:05.5 to 8:02.88. They would run on to win the 4×800 relay race.

“It felt great to set a new record. The competition was difficult, but it was very rewarding “- Caden Cutchall ’24

Another notable finish was from Freshman Jesse Jenkins who finished third in his first varsity meet, hopping above the 13-foot bar. He ended the meet with a hard-fought third-place finished.

Junior Rodrigo Navarro set a new personal record, clearing the 5-10 bar and placing fourth in the high jump category.

Lastly, Senior Jameson kemp, in the shot put, placed eighth with a 42-0 throw and Senior Charlie Humbert finished sixth in the 300-meter hurdles at 43.14

The Ranger’s next meet will be this weekend, February 24th, at the Allen Eagle Relays at the Lowery Freshman Center.
